Planning appeal decision
90 Heron Drive, Lenton, NOTTINGHAM, NG7 2DG
single-storey rear extension to existing HMO property
- Authority
- Nottingham City Council
- Appeal type
- minor · Planning Appeal
- Procedure
- Written Representations
- Development
- residential · Other minor developments
- Inspector
- Bartlett R
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- The effect of the development on the creation and maintenance of balanced and sustainable communities
- The living conditions of occupiers of nearby dwellings
What decided it
The cumulative impact of increasing HMO households in an area already significantly overconcentrated with such uses, combined with the harmful effects on parking and noise affecting neighbouring residential amenity.
